C# Succinctly

July 11, 2015

C# Succinctly

C# is a general purpose, object-oriented, component-based programming language. As a general purpose language, there are a number of ways to apply C# to accomplish many different tasks. You can build web applications with ASP.NET, desktop applications with Windows Presentation Foundation, or build mobile applications for Windows Phone. Other applications include code that runs in the cloud via Windows Azure, and iOS, Android, and Windows Phone support with the Xamarin platform. With C# Succinctly by Joe Mayo, you will quickly learn the syntax you need to build your own C# applications.

Book Description

Topics included: Introducing C# and .NET • Coding Expressions and Statements • Methods and Properties • Writing Object-Oriented Code • Handling Delegates, Events, and Lambdas • Working with Collections and Generics • Querying Objects with LINQ • Making Your Code Asynchronous • Moving Forward and More Things to Know.
